On Thu, Jul 09, 2020 at 04:26:57PM -0500, Bill O'Donnell wrote:
> Since grace periods are now supported for three quota types (ugp),
> modify xfs_quota state command to report times for all three.

This looks like it'll clash with the patch that Darrick just sent..

> +	if (type & XFS_USER_QUOTA) {
> +		if (xfsquotactl(XFS_GETQSTATV, dev, XFS_USER_QUOTA,
> +				0, (void *)&sv) < 0) {
> +			if (xfsquotactl(XFS_GETQSTAT, dev, XFS_USER_QUOTA,
> +					0, (void *)&s) < 0) {
> +				if (flags & VERBOSE_FLAG)
> +					fprintf(fp,
> +						_("%s quota are not enabled on %s\n"),
> +						type_to_string(XFS_USER_QUOTA),
> +						dev);
> +				return;
> +			}
> +			state_stat_to_statv(&s, &sv);
>  		}
>  
>  		state_qfilestat(fp, mount, XFS_USER_QUOTA, &sv.qs_uquota,
>  				sv.qs_flags & XFS_QUOTA_UDQ_ACCT,
>  				sv.qs_flags & XFS_QUOTA_UDQ_ENFD);
> +		state_timelimit(fp, XFS_BLOCK_QUOTA, sv.qs_btimelimit);
> +		state_timelimit(fp, XFS_INODE_QUOTA, sv.qs_itimelimit);
> +		state_timelimit(fp, XFS_RTBLOCK_QUOTA, sv.qs_rtbtimelimit);
> +	}

Any chance we could factor this repititive code into a helper?
